Did you know we have an emerging trend at school, phone, internet capable and camera watches? We have noticed a growing number of children coming to school with watches that are a phone, can access the internet and have a camera. Please note if your child has one of these devices so that you can stay in touch they will need to remove it during the school day for the safety of all. There is a significant risk to children when others have access to cameras, the web and phone lines without teacher supervision. Please support the school and our efforts to keep all children safe by ensuring your child does not come to school wearing these types of devices.

HELPER APPRECIATION and INFORMATION SESSION

The PTA and our Y6 students are organising a ‘Helper Appreciation and Information Session' as part of KJS Action Day from 2.00-2.45 pm on Thursday 31 May. In the past this event has been an ‘Aunty Party' where parents have sent along their domestic helpers and their children have presented the helpers with a homemade card. We would like to hold the event again this year to show our appreciation for these wonderful ladies and also offer some information about healthy snacks and ideas to reduce plastic packaging for the students snacks and lunches. Y6 students will present information rather than cards; however, KJS students will be given the opportunity to write thank you messages to their helpers which will be displayed for the whole community to see.

Details on how to create the appreciation messages will be given to all students by those exhibition groups involved this week. All students whose helpers attend the session will be released from their classes at approximately 2.30 pm to share the last part of the event with their helper.

All domestic helper participants will enjoy a tea party with cakes & treats provided by Ms Hong, our bakery tutor from Flour.  These cakes will be healthy option recipes and can be baked without using lots of individual packaging.  Copies of the recipes will be available so the whole family can enjoy them at home.
